I don't know anything about pyserial, but it sounds like ser.read(1)
is blocking until it returns one byte. If that is a blocking call, that will freeze your GUI. You will have to either configure the serial port to allow non-blocking calls, or do the read in a separate thread.
Tkinter Freezing when calling Pyserial Function from Button

I am creating a graphical interface for my serial communications program. The layout for the gui is set up how I want and I have begun to try and add some of the serial code. However, I have run across a problem. When I click the "Test Connection" button or b1, the program freezes up and stops responding. Not the following code left out things I thought unnecessary. I have narrowed the problem down to read = ser.read(1). For some reason ser.read() is killing it. Thanks for any help in advance!
